Return to the Top page HD Radio Receive Mode You can set the radio broadcasts receive mode. 1 Touch [ ] in the control screen. The multi function menu appears. 2 Touch [RCV] in the multi function menu. HD Radio tuner Mode screen appears. 3 Select the receive mode from [Auto], [Digital], and [Analog] using [C] and [D]. NOTE • If you select [Auto], tunes to analog broadcast automatically when there is no digital broadcast. iTunes Tagging You can tag your music using an iTunes Tagging enabled HD Radio tuner. The saved songs will then be stored in a playlist called "Tagged" in iTunes the next time you sync your iPod with your computer. "Tagged" songs can then be directly purchased and downloaded from the Apple iTunes Music Store by clicking them. ÑÑRegistering a tag NOTE • "TAG" will be indicated on the display when song information can be registered. 1 Press the button instructed in each diagram for 1 second during listening to the song from HD Radio station. Return to the Top page HD Radio Bookmark Stores tag information (title, artist, album, URL, and description) about the song you are listening to now. Detailed information and QR codes can be displayed according to the stored tag information. ÑÑRegistering a bookmark 1 Touch [ ]. Sub function menu appears. 2 Touch [ ]. Registers a bookmark. NOTE • Up to 100 bookmarks can be registered to this unit. HOME 6 NOTE • Up to 50 tags can be registered to this unit.
